    I've just taken delivery of a new M200, and spent the evening setting it up. However when I came to put my new toy away I pushed the pen into the slot (hole) in the right hand side of the case, however there seems to be no spring release as documented in the manual, and the pen won't pop out. I've tried to pull it out with tweezers to no avail. Has anyone else had a similar problem? if necessary I'll have to send the thing to Toshiba support but it would be nice to be able to get it out myself rather than send it away. The problem isn't a show-stopper as I have other wacom pens that work OK with the M200, but it's annoying to break the thing within a day of getting it.

    Got the PC back from Toshiba repairers (UK), full marks to them efficient pickup, turnaround, and return. The outcome was that the pen holder needed reseating, I assume that it was out of alignment and consequently the pen got stuck (I just hope it didn't end up poking into the PC internals). I thought I'd just post the outcome in case anyone else gets a similar problem in future.
